What is the Universal Brotherhood Movement, Inc.?
Universal Brotherhood Movement, Inc., is an association composed of persons who have requested recognition of their independent ministries and have been officially ordained by U.B.M., Inc. Each minister names his or her ministry and conducts it in the manner they deem fitting and proper.
U.B.M., Inc., was Incorporated in 1976 as a not-for-profit corporation to satisfy the legal requirements for persons practicing spiritual service.

How does Universal Brotherhood Movement, Inc. work?
Persons who are committed to expressing their lives by serving others may request ordination through Universal Brotherhood. A minister ordained by U.B.M., Inc., may legally officiate at weddings, baptisms, funerals, services of dedication and make ministerial hospital calls, subject to local civil regulation.
Association with Universal Brotherhood as a minister does not alter one’s affiliation or commitment to his or her church or other religious institution. One may continue to be active in any faith or philosophy.

Who are Universal Brotherhood Movement Ministers?
Persons ordained by U.B.M., Inc., are dedicated, spiritually oriented individuals who desire to reach out to others in unconditional and non-judgmental love.

What are Universal Brotherhood Movement’s Doctrines?
There is no required belief in any particular doctrine or creedal statement. U.B.M., Inc. considers each person as an individual who is on her or his own “path” – a unique expression of Life. How are Ministers Chosen?
U.B.M., Inc. considers and acts upon each request for ordination. There is no solicitation or promoting for applicants for ordination. Individuals must request ordination and recognition of their ministry.

What are the requirements for requesting Ordination?
A person should accept the Oneness of all Life. During the ordination ceremony, the applicant is asked to affirm, “I hereby dedicate my life to the brotherhood of mankind.”
A biographical/philosophical statement is required with the application. This is an autobiographical, spiritual bio-sketch delineating your personal path and your purpose in requesting ordination. The essay can be a rich and expanding experience. Take time to allow it to express your uniqueness. Please do not send printed brochures, workshop or seminar flyers, or newsletters you produce. Your personal statement is the key requirement.
Along with your bio-sketch, a current photo, and a data form that contains a formal request for ordination (please fill out completely and legibly) are submitted to the administrative office.
When your application is processed, the Minister/Director nearest you will call you for a personal interview and arrange for your ordination. Your guests are welcome to attend the ceremony.

Where do ministers ordained by Universal Brotherhood Movement, Inc. get their training?
Since Universal Brotherhood makes no attempt to influence or change an individual’s philosophical beliefs, no seminary is required. Each applicant is recognized and honored for their own unique ministry. Although many persons ordained hold advanced educational degrees, each applicant is awarded a Bachelor of Divinity degree at ordination in recognition of life work/experience.

How is Universal Brotherhood Movement, Inc. supported?
Annual dues maintain UB’s Administrative office and provide a newsletter. This also keeps each minister in “active” status. Each minister supports his/her own ministry. Each candidate for the ministry is expected to provide funds to cover the expense of application, processing, enrollment and the ordination ceremony itself. Within the United States, a $95 ordination fee plus the first year dues, $65, are required ($160 total). Outside of the United States, a $95 ordination fee plus the first year dues of $80 (due to higher mailing costs) are required ($175 total). The annual dues are payable on the anniversary of your ordination.
